Creative Ideas: What to Do with Frozen Watermelon

Frozen watermelon is incredibly versatile. Here are several practical and delicious ways to use it:

  1. Classic Frozen Watermelon Smoothie

Blend 2 cups SALAGRI IQF frozen watermelon chunks with a banana, a splash of coconut water, and lime juice for a hydrating, naturally sweet smoothie. Add frozen mango or coconut chunks for extra tropical flavor.

  1. Watermelon Slushie or Margarita

Pulse frozen watermelon with lime juice, a touch of honey, and ice (or tequila for an adult version) for a refreshing slushie. The frozen fruit eliminates the need for extra ice, resulting in a thicker, more flavorful drink.

  1. Watermelon Sorbet or Nice Cream

Blend frozen watermelon with a small amount of coconut milk or banana, then freeze for 1–2 hours, stirring occasionally. This creates a light, dairy-free sorbet or creamy nice cream.

  1. Fruit Salad or Bowl Topping

Slightly thaw frozen watermelon chunks and toss with other frozen tropical fruits for a quick, colorful fruit salad or smoothie bowl topping.

  1. Savory Applications

Use thawed frozen watermelon in chilled soups, salsas, or as a refreshing garnish for grilled dishes. Its mild sweetness balances spicy or savory flavors.

These ideas demonstrate how frozen watermelon can be used beyond basic smoothies, making it a valuable pantry staple.

Benefits of Frozen Tropical Fruit and Frozen Watermelon

Freezing tropical fruit at peak ripeness is one of the most effective ways to preserve nutritional value. Properly IQF-processed fruits retain 90–95% of their vitamins, antioxidants, and enzymes, often matching or exceeding fresh equivalents that have undergone long-distance shipping and storage.

Frozen watermelon, in particular, retains its vibrant color, natural lycopene (a powerful antioxidant), and hydrating properties. Key benefits include:

  • High water content for natural hydration
  • Rich in lycopene and vitamin C for immune and skin support
  • Low calorie density with natural sweetness
  • Convenient ready-to-use format that reduces waste
  • Year-round availability and cost predictability

When combined with other frozen tropical fruits like mango or coconut, frozen watermelon creates balanced, nutrient-dense recipes. Frozen coconut adds natural creaminess and medium-chain triglycerides (MCTs) for sustained energy, complementing watermelon’s refreshing profile.
